New Leeds signing Karl Darlow has tipped the club to have a ‘special season’ this year

New Leeds United signing Karl Darlow, who arrived from Newcastle on 29 July, has tipped the club to have a “special season” in an interview with LUTV.

Darlow has instantly given a salute to the passionate Elland Road crowd, revealing his view that the fans could play a massive part in helping the side in the Championship this season.

The ex-Newcastle man has arrived at Leeds as the club’s priority target to strengthen between the posts with Illan Meslier still expected to leave the club this summer, and will have done no harm to his reputation among the fans with these comments.

Speaking to LUTV in his first interview with the club, Darlow stated: “When this place is bouncing it’s intimidating to come as an away team. If we can get the fans behind us and play good football and attractive football and winning matches then everything adds up and it could be a special season.”

The shot-stopper was then asked whether playing in front of the Elland Road crowd was a big part in bringing him to the club when he revealed: “Absolutely, especially when you see how passionate they are. I have just come from one club that are very, very passionate about their football to another so it’s something that I am used to and something that I am excited to carry on throughout my career.”
